    Thu, Jan 03, 2013 | 17:33 GMT
    Wii U holiday hardware and software sales at GameStop “below expectations” – analyst

    Sterne Agee analyst Arvind Bhatia has said in his latest investor note that sales of Wii U hardware and software at GameStop were below expectations over the holiday period.

    According to Bhatia, the console and its subsequent software remained “abundant,” in quantity despite suggestions from various sectors citing a possible shortage.
    Bhatia also noted the $350 Wii U Deluxe model is moving off GameStop shelves faster than the basic $300 model, due to being a “better value.”
    “Our conclusion is the Nintendo Wii U launch has been slightly disappointing,” he said.
    The analyst also claimed the attach rate for Wii U software at GameStop was “low,” without revealing any actual figures.
